NEW DELHI: Copper prices on Thursday traded up by 0.43 per cent at Rs 763.75 per kg in the futures market on the back of a pickup in spot demand.
On the Multi Commodity Exchange, copper contracts for May delivery traded higher by Rs 3.25, or 0.43 per cent, at Rs 763.75 per kg in a business turnover of 3,423 lots.
Analysts attributed the rise in copper prices to raising of bets by participants driven by the pickup in spot demand.
